Escape to Vienna's Stadtpark: A historic green space with iconic monuments, tranquil gardens, and classical concerts in the heart of the city.
Vienna's Stadtpark, established in 1862, is a sprawling green space in the heart of the city, offering a tranquil escape with its English landscape design, iconic monuments like the Johann Strauss statue, and the Kursalon, a historic concert venue. The Wien River meanders through the park, adding to its picturesque charm.

Public Transport
For the final approach to Stadtpark, the U4 metro line is the most convenient option. Take the U4 to the 'Stadtpark' station, which exits directly into the park. Alternatively, the U3 line stops at 'Stubentor' station, a short walk to the park. Numerous tram and bus lines also have stops near the park's perimeter. A single public transport ticket costs €2.40.
Walking
Stadtpark is centrally located and easily accessible on foot from many of Vienna's main attractions. From St. Stephen's Cathedral, walk east along Kärntner Straße, then turn left onto the Ringstrasse (Parkring). Continue along the Ringstrasse for a few blocks until you reach the Stadtpark entrance on your right. The walk is approximately 15-20 minutes and offers views of Vienna's grand architecture. There are no costs associated with walking.
Taxi/Ride-Share
A taxi or ride-share from the city center (e.g., St. Stephen's Cathedral) to Stadtpark typically costs between €10 and €20, depending on the distance and traffic. Taxi rates in Vienna start at €3.80, with additional charges per kilometer. Keep in mind that ordering a taxi by phone may incur an extra charge. Ride-sharing services like Uber are also available.
Driving
If driving, be aware that the area around Stadtpark is a short-term parking zone (Kurzparkzone) from Monday to Friday, 9 am to 10 pm, with a maximum parking time of 2 hours. Parking tickets (Parkschein) are required and cost around €2.50 per hour. Alternatively, several parking garages are located near Stadtpark, including Garage Am Stadtpark (Am Stadtpark 1) with hourly rates around €4.20 and a daily maximum of €34.90.
